New
Model
Review:R1200ST
-
110
horsepower
packaged
into
a
505
lb.
motorcycle
with
a
total
of
six
color
combinations.
Standard
features
include
heated
handgrips,
adjustable
seat
and
windshield,
and
partially
integrated
ABS.
Options
include
BMW's
revolutionary
Electronic
Suspension
Adjustment
(ESA),
saddlebags,
luggage
rack
and
topcase,
and
two
tankbags.R1200RT
-
110
horsepower
packaged
into
a
571
lb.
motorcycle
available
in
three
primary
colors
with
lower
fairing
and
seat
colors
available
in
black
and
grey.
Standard
features
include
heated
handgrips,
heated
seat,
electronic
cruise
control,
powered
windscreen,
and
saddlebages.
Options
include
BMW's
revolutionary
Electronic
Suspension
Adjustment
(ESA),
two
tankbags,
two
different
sized
topcases,
and
saddlebag
and
topcase
liners.
K1200S
-
167
horsepower
packaged
into
a
561
lb.
motorcycle
available
in
two
solid
colors
and
two
two-tone
paint
schemes.
Standard
features
include
heated
handgrips,
and
partially
integrated
ABS.
Options
include
BMW's
revolutionary
Electronic
Suspension
Adjustment
(ESA),
two
tankbags,
expandable
saddlebags,
and
softbags.
